Michael Canavan

Born: 1953-08-17 • Portsmouth, Virginia, USA

Michael Canavan (born August 17, 1953, in Portsmouth, Virginia) is an American actor known for his work in film, television, and theater. He has appeared in notable films including The Island (2005), Striking Distance (1993), Flags of Our Fathers (2006), Hidalgo (2004), and Murder by Numbers. His television credits feature recurring roles on shows such as 7th Heaven, Hunter, and General Hospital, with guest appearances on Grey’s Anatomy, Mad Men, Bones, Criminal Minds, and Entourage. Canavan is also an accomplished stage actor with credits from prestigious theaters including Goodman Theatre and Steppenwolf Theatre Company. Additionally, he has done voice work, narrating the Bible for Warner New Media and voicing the Marquis de Sade for the History Channel. He has been married to actress Shannon Cochran since June 14, 2003
